問題タブ [pdf-generation]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
vb.net - VB.NETのPDFファイル(VB 6からのアップグレードの問題)
プロジェクトをvb6からVB.NETにアップグレードしました。プロジェクトはPDFファイルを生成するために使用されます..アップグレード中に次の問題が発生します。
コード:
'UPGRADE_ISSUE:定数vbUnicodeはアップグレードされませんでした。詳細については、ここをクリックしてください:
'ms-help://MS.VSCC.2003/commoner/redir/redirect.htm?keyword = "vbup2070"''taptisColor = IIf(mvarEncodeASCII85、ToASCII85(ImgColor)、StrConv(System.Text.UnicodeEncoding .Unicode.GetString(ImgColor)、vbUnicode))sColor = IIf(mvarEncodeASCII85、ToASCII85(ImgColor)、
DecodeString(System.Text.Encoding.UTF8.GetString(ImgColor)))'sColor = IIf(mvarEncodeASCII85、ToASCII85(ImgColor)、
StrConv(System.Text.UnicodeEncoding.Unicode.GetString(ImgColor)、VbStrConv.None))
問題は、画像をロゴとして表示する必要がある場所に黒色の四角形が表示されることです。
助けてください。Unicodeアップグレードの問題を解決するにはどうすればよいですか?
ありがとう!
java - HTML ファイルを PDF に変換する
既存の (X)HTML ドキュメントから PDF ファイルを自動的に生成する必要があります。入力ファイル (レポート) はかなり単純なテーブル ベースのレイアウトを使用するため、非常に高度な JavaScript/CSS のサポートはおそらく必要ありません。
私は Java での作業に慣れているので、Java プロジェクトで簡単に使用できるソリューションが望ましいです。ただし、Windows システムでのみ動作する必要があります。
実行可能ですが、高品質の出力を (少なくともすぐに) 生成しない方法の 1 つは、CSS2XSLFOと Apache FOP を使用して PDF ファイルを作成することです。私が遭遇した問題は、CSS 属性が適切に変換されている一方で、テーブル レイアウトがかなり混乱しており、テキストがテーブル セルからはみ出してしまうことでした。
また、Gecko レンダリング エンジンを使用するための Java-API である Jrex についても簡単に調べました。
Internet Explorer のレンダリング エンジンからレンダリングされたページを取得し、それを PDF-Printer ツールに自動的に送信する方法はありますか? Windows での OLE プログラミングの経験がないので、何が可能で何が不可能かわかりません。
アイデアはありますか?
c# - 動的に生成された PDF ファイルがユーザーに表示された直後に削除する
ITextSharp と ASP.NET 1.1 を使用して、その場で PDF ファイルを作成しています。私のプロセスは次のとおりです-
- サーバー上にファイルを作成する
- ユーザーに表示されるように、ブラウザーを新しく作成された PDF ファイルにリダイレクトします。
私がしたいのは、ユーザーのブラウザーに表示されたらすぐにサーバーから PDF を削除することです。PDF ファイルは大きいため、メモリに保持するオプションはありません。サーバーへの初期書き込みが必要です。私は現在、ファイルを定期的にポーリングして削除するソリューションを使用していますが、クライアント マシンにダウンロードされた直後にファイルを削除するソリューションを希望します。これを行う方法はありますか?
python - PythonでPDFドキュメントにPDFにページを含める方法
Python で reportlab ツールキットを使用して、PDF 形式のレポートを生成しています。生成された PDF ファイルに含めるために、既に PDF 形式で公開されているドキュメントの事前定義された部分を使用したいと考えています。reportlabまたはpythonライブラリでこれを達成することは可能ですか(そしてどのように)?
PDF Toolkit (pdftk) などの他のツールを使用できることはわかっていますが、Python ベースのソリューションを探しています。
pdf - テンプレートに基づいて高解像度の PDF を動的に作成する方法
PDF を作成するテンプレート化されたパンフレットを作成する最良の方法を見つけようとしています。テキスト領域と画像領域を持つテンプレートがある場合、そのテンプレートは既に定義されており、公開時にユーザー値を取得して領域に挿入し、高解像度または低解像度として公開します。これは InDesign サーバーの実装のみですか?
ms-word - MOSS2007でドキュメント変換を実装する方法を探しています
私たちは、MOSSワークフローの作成を任されており、その最終ステップで、ドキュメント(ほとんどの場合、2003年または2007年のワードから)をPDFに変換し、現在の日付で透かしを入れます。
これまでのところ、これを行うための決定的な方法は見ていません。MS Word Interop dllの使用を検討しましたが、Word(またはOffice)をサーバーにインストールしないため、実際には実行できません。私が見たもう1つのオプションは、変換にAsposedllライブラリを使用することです。
トポロジの観点から、ドキュメント変換専用に1台のサーバーを使用することがこれを実装するための良い方法であるかどうか疑問に思います。(大規模な組織にこのアプローチを推奨する情報をいくつか読みました)。
この種のことを好んで行った人がいれば、これに関するいくつかの指針やベストプラクティスを教えていただければ幸いです。
ありがとう
pdf - PS/PDF はどのようにビットマップを保存および圧縮しますか?
文字をスキャンし、スキャンしたビットマップを PDF に変換するシステムを試して、高解像度と小さな PDF ファイル サイズを実現しようとしています。
スキャナー、ビットマップ操作用の GIMP、ビットマップから PDF への変換用の ImageMagick でプロトタイプを作成しています。
私のプロセスは次のようになります。
3x8bit カラー、600 DPI、LZW 圧縮のトゥルーカラー TIFF ファイル サイズでスキャンすると、約 8 Mb になります。
GIMP を使用して、ビットマップを 4 ~ 8 色の一般的なカラー テーブルを持つインデックス付きイメージに変換します。これにより、画像の圧縮性が向上します。
ImageMagick を使用して、LZW 圧縮のインデックス付き TIFF ファイル PDF を、1 ページあたり約 500K に変換します。
画像をさらに圧縮しやすくするために、ビットマップをより圧縮しやすくすることができます。ここで実験する前に、PS/PDF がビットマップを格納する方法を知りたいと思います。
PS/PDF のビットマップはランレングスでエンコードされていますか? 次に、ビットマップ行から単一のピクセルを削除して圧縮します。
ここでさらに最適化するためのアイデアはありますか?
PS/PDF のビットマップ ストレージ形式に関する参照情報を知っていますか?
asp.net - HTML を PDF に変換するときにルック アンド フィールを維持する方法
私は iTextSharp を使用して HTML から PDF への変換を行ってきましたが、全体的にはかなりうまく機能しますが、ほとんどの書式設定とは異なります。
太字、イタリック、および下線はすべて機能しますが、フォント サイズ、スタイル、またはその他の情報は考慮されないため、エクスポートはフォーマットの作成に使用された HTML とはまったく異なります。
誰も方法を知っていますか
- iTextSharp のエクスポート方法を修正します (以下は私のコードのサンプルです)
- または、この機能を提供し、破綻しない別の製品を知っていますか?
これは私のコードです: